Their food is great, especially their daily special at only $4.50 and soda pop for $0.75, you really can't beat the price and taste. As to their selection...well lets just say less is more.
Menu Items and Cost
Chicken Teriyaki 4.50 special or 5.75 regular
Beef Teriyaki 6
Pork Teriyaki 6
Beef and Chicken 6.50
Pork and Chicken 6.50
Chicken Fried Rice 6.25
Chicken Sandwhich 4.50
x-tra meat 2.25

This place has the tastiest teriyaki in Seattle. We used to call it Scary Teri because it was located right by a drug rehab center, but it was a popular place with Amazonians working across the street. Definitely one of those hole in the wall places you'd never think to try unless someone told you about it. Try the teriyaki with some Asian hot sauce on the side, and do the takeout thing, since the place isn't known for its atmosphere.
